TrueBridge Capital Partners Surpasses $7.5 Billion in Assets Under Management Following Successful Fund Closures

TrueBridge Capital Partners, a leading venture capital investment firm, has announced the successful completion of fundraising for five new investment vehicles, amassing $1.6 billion in commitments. This significant achievement propels the firm’s total assets under management (AUM) to over $7.5 billion. The newly closed funds include TrueBridge Capital Partners Fund VIII, TrueBridge Seed & Micro-VC II, TrueBridge Direct Fund III, TrueBridge Secondaries I, and TrueBridge Blockchain I. These funds garnered substantial backing from both existing limited partners and a diverse group of new investors, encompassing foundations, endowments, pension funds, family offices, and high-net-worth individuals.

TrueBridge Capital Partners Fund VIII, L.P., the firm’s flagship fund of funds, closed at $884 million, exceeding its initial fundraising target. This eighth venture capital fund will continue TrueBridge’s long-standing and successful strategy of investing in top-tier, access-constrained venture capital firms, primarily those focused on early-stage technology companies. Fund VIII will maintain this disciplined approach, concentrating on high-performing venture firms while ensuring diversification across various technology sectors and investment vintages.

TrueBridge Seed & Micro-VC II, L.P. finalized its capital raise with $189 million in commitments. TrueBridge Capital Partners expanded its investment strategy to include the seed stage in 2011, subsequently launching its inaugural dedicated seed & micro-VC fund of funds in 2019. Building upon the accomplishments of its predecessor fund, Seed & Micro-VC II reinforces the firm’s sustained dedication to investing in seed and micro-VC managers who are focused on cultivating companies from their earliest inception.

Direct Fund III, L.P., dedicated to direct investments in technology companies, concluded fundraising with $253 million in total commitments. Direct Fund III represents TrueBridge Capital Partners’ third vehicle for direct investments into select mid- to late-stage technology companies, co-investing alongside highly regarded venture capital managers. TrueBridge’s extensive network and strong relationships with its fund managers provide valuable early access to critical market intelligence, deal flow, and introductions to key management teams. The firm’s direct investment activity began in 2008, with the first dedicated direct investment fund launched in 2015.

TrueBridge Secondaries I, L.P. marks the firm’s entry into the venture secondaries market, closing its first dedicated secondaries fund at $230 million in commitments. Secondaries I aims to construct a diversified portfolio comprising stakes in top-performing mid- to late-stage companies and venture funds, capitalizing on the expanding venture secondaries market. By leveraging its deep-rooted relationships and comprehensive understanding of the venture capital ecosystem, TrueBridge Secondaries I is well-positioned to capitalize on compelling opportunities within this evolving market sector.

TrueBridge Blockchain I, L.P., the firm’s inaugural fund focused on blockchain technology, completed its fundraising with $62 million in total commitments. With Blockchain I, TrueBridge Capital Partners seeks to assemble a curated portfolio of leading blockchain-focused venture funds and promising companies within the blockchain sector. This specialized fund enables the firm to effectively tap into the underlying momentum within the blockchain market, while simultaneously addressing the growing demand from limited partners for exposure to this complex and rapidly evolving area.

Since its inception in 2007, TrueBridge Capital Partners has maintained an exclusive focus on venture capital investments. This encompasses commitments to access-constrained venture capital managers and direct investments in high-growth technology startups alongside select venture firms. Over the past decade, TrueBridge has strategically expanded its venture capital platform, establishing specialized funds to support both of these core investment strategies.
